feat(frontend): keyboard navigation for tag and category grids
deploy / deploy (push) Successful in 23s

Mirror the Files grid's roving keyboard focus on the tag and category
lists (and the tags shown on a category page): arrows move a focus ring,
Enter opens the focused item, "/" jumps to search, Escape drops the ring.
Extracts the model into a reusable createRovingGrid controller; vertical
movement is geometric since the pills wrap at variable widths. The
tag/category edit pages gain Escape-to-leave parity with the file viewer.

@@ -0,0 +1,173 @@
// Reusable roving keyboard-focus for a wrap/grid of items navigated by id —
// the same model the Files grid uses (arrows move a focus ring, Enter opens,
// "/" jumps to search, Escape drops the ring), generalised so the tag and
// category lists can share it.
//
// Unlike the Files grid (fixed 160px cards → computable columns), tags and
// categories are variable-width pills that wrap, so vertical movement is
// geometric: pick the nearest item in the target row by horizontal centre.
interface Item {
id?: string;
}
interface RovingGridOptions<T extends Item> {
/** Reactive getter for the current item list (in render order). */
items: () => T[];
/** The scroll container holding the item elements. */
container: () => HTMLElement | undefined;
/** Open / activate the focused item (Enter). */
onOpen: (item: T) => void;
/** Focus the page's search box ("/"). Optional. */
focusSearch?: () => void;
/** CSS selector for the focusable item elements within the container. */
itemSelector?: string;
}
export function createRovingGrid<T extends Item>(opts: RovingGridOptions<T>) {
const selector = opts.itemSelector ?? '[data-item-index]';
let focusedId = $state<string | null>(null);
// Gate the focus ring so it only shows once the user navigates by keyboard.
let kbActive = $state(false);
// Drop the focus if its item leaves the loaded/filtered list.
$effect(() => {
const list = opts.items();
if (focusedId && !list.some((it) => it.id === focusedId)) {
focusedId = null;
}
});
function isFormTarget(t: EventTarget | null): boolean {
return (
t instanceof HTMLElement &&
(t.isContentEditable ||
['INPUT', 'TEXTAREA', 'SELECT', 'BUTTON', 'A'].includes(t.tagName))
);
}
function els(): HTMLElement[] {
const root = opts.container();
return root ? [...root.querySelectorAll<HTMLElement>(selector)] : [];
}
function currentIndex(list: T[]): number {
return focusedId ? list.findIndex((it) => it.id === focusedId) : -1;
}
function focusAt(idx: number, list: T[]) {
const id = list[idx]?.id;
if (!id) return;
kbActive = true;
focusedId = id;
requestAnimationFrame(() => {
els()[idx]?.scrollIntoView({ block: 'nearest' });
});
}
// Horizontal step is index-based; vertical step is geometric (items wrap at
// variable widths, so there's no fixed column count to add/subtract).
function move(dir: 'left' | 'right' | 'up' | 'down') {
const list = opts.items();
if (list.length === 0) return;
const cur = currentIndex(list);
if (cur < 0) {
focusAt(0, list);
return;
}
if (dir === 'left') {
focusAt(Math.max(0, cur - 1), list);
return;
}
if (dir === 'right') {
focusAt(Math.min(list.length - 1, cur + 1), list);
return;
}
// up / down: nearest item in the target direction, preferring the closest
// row, then the closest horizontal centre.
const nodes = els();
const curRect = nodes[cur]?.getBoundingClientRect();
if (!curRect) return;
const curMidX = curRect.left + curRect.width / 2;
let best = -1;
let bestScore = Infinity;
for (let i = 0; i < nodes.length; i++) {
if (i === cur) continue;
const r = nodes[i].getBoundingClientRect();
const wanted = dir === 'down' ? r.top > curRect.top + 1 : r.top < curRect.top - 1;
if (!wanted) continue;
const dy = Math.abs(r.top - curRect.top);
const dx = Math.abs(r.left + r.width / 2 - curMidX);
const score = dy * 100000 + dx; // row distance dominates, x breaks ties
if (score < bestScore) {
bestScore = score;
best = i;
}
}
if (best >= 0) focusAt(best, list);
}
function handleKey(e: KeyboardEvent) {
if (e.metaKey || e.ctrlKey || e.altKey) return;
if (e.key === 'Escape') {
if (focusedId) {
focusedId = null;
kbActive = false;
}
return;
}
// "/" focuses the search box from anywhere outside a field.
if (e.key === '/' && opts.focusSearch && !isFormTarget(e.target)) {
e.preventDefault();
opts.focusSearch();
return;
}
if (isFormTarget(e.target)) return;
switch (e.key) {
case 'ArrowRight':
e.preventDefault();
move('right');
return;
case 'ArrowLeft':
e.preventDefault();
move('left');
return;
case 'ArrowDown':
e.preventDefault();
move('down');
return;
case 'ArrowUp':
e.preventDefault();
move('up');
return;
case 'Enter': {
const list = opts.items();
const cur = currentIndex(list);
if (cur >= 0) {
e.preventDefault();
opts.onOpen(list[cur]);
}
return;
}
}
}
return {
get focusedId() {
return focusedId;
},
get kbActive() {
return kbActive;
},
/** Clear the keyboard ring (e.g. on a pointer interaction). */
clearKbActive() {
kbActive = false;
},
handleKey
};
}
